About ZIP Code 08054

ZIP code 08054 is located in Mount Laurel, New Jersey, within Burlington County. With a population of 45,427, this is a highly populated ZIP code with a middle-aged community — the median age is 43.1 years. Economically, 08054 is a upper-middle-income ZIP code: the median household income of $114,629 is significantly above the national average.

Real estate in ZIP code 08054 represents a mid-range housing market. The median home value of $341,400 is above the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$1,966 per month in median rent. Homeownership is strong here — 76.2% of occupied units are owner-occupied, suggesting an established, stable residential community. Median home values have increased by 25% since 2019.

The population of 08054 is majority White (65.08%). Residents are highly educated — 63.1%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is significantly above the national average. Poverty affects a relatively small share of residents at 4.2%. Household income has grown by 21% since 2019.

The unemployment rate in 08054 stands at 3.7%, which is below the national average. About 19% of workers are remote. As in most parts of the country, driving alone is the dominant commute mode at 74%.

Overall, ZIP code 08054 in Mount Laurel, NJ is characterized as upper-middle-income, highly educated, a middle-aged community, and predominantly owner-occupied.
